3. Core Messaging Automation Scripts for Lead Conversion

Initial Contact Script: Warm and Informative

An effective first message sets the tone. Automation scripts use CRM data to personalize greetings and introduce your services succinctly, e.g., “Hi [Name], thanks for your interest! I’d love to help you find your perfect home. When’s a good time to chat?” This initial prompt engages without overwhelming.

Follow-Up Reminder Script: Polite Persistence

Timely nudges keep your leads engaged. For instance, “Just checking in, [Name]. Have you had a chance to review the listings I sent? I’m here to help with any questions!” Automating these messages reduces missed opportunities.

Appointment Confirmation Script: Reducing No-Shows

Confirming appointments with clear, automated reminders, e.g., “Looking forward to our tour tomorrow at 3pm. Please reply ‘YES’ to confirm or suggest a new time,” improves attendance and signals professionalism.

8. Comparison Table: Top Automation Script Messaging Types for Real Estate Lead Conversion

Script Type Purpose Typical Timing Automation Complexity Expected Conversion Impact
Initial Contact Introduce agent and qualify lead interest Within 5 min of lead capture Low High—sets engagement tone
Follow-Up Reminder Ensure lead responds or schedules appointment 1-3 days after initial message Medium Moderate—improves response rate
Appointment Confirmation Confirm visits and reduce no-shows 1 day before appointment Low High—boosts attendance
Post-Appointment Follow-up Gauge interest and push for next steps Within 24 hours of tour Medium Moderate—keeps momentum
Closing Push Address objections and prompt contract signing After offer is made High—may include conditional logic High—critical final step
Pro Tip: Combine automation with personalized phone calls at critical stages, such as after showing or before closing, to maximize conversion effectiveness.

Ensuring Compliance with Messaging Regulations

Stay compliant with TCPA and local SMS marketing laws by obtaining explicit consent and including opt-out options in scripts.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

1. Can automation scripts be customized for different lead types?

Yes, scripts should be tailored for buyer, seller, or renter leads with relevant messaging and call-to-actions, enhancing relevance and engagement.

2. What platforms work best for automating SMS in real estate?

Popular integrations include Twilio, Plivo, and native CRM SMS tools connected via APIs. Tasking.Space supports many such integrations for seamless automation.

3. How do I ensure leads don’t feel spammed by automated messages?

Personalize messages, limit frequency, and respect opt-outs to maintain a respectful communication cadence.

4. Is it possible to automate responses to common lead questions?

Yes, using chatbots and predefined keyword-triggered responses can handle FAQs, freeing agents to focus on complex interactions.

5. How quickly should I follow up with a new lead?

Data indicates responding within 5 minutes dramatically increases engagement chances; automation makes this feasible at scale.
